Touring cycling in East Macedonia-Thrace National Park offers diverse landscapes, from extensive wetlands to mountainous terrain and a 100 km coastline. The park encompasses significant natural features such as the Nestos Delta with its meandering river bends and riparian forests, and Lake Vistonida, a large brackish body of water. To the north, the Rhodope Mountains provide a backdrop of dense forests and varying elevations. This region provides a range of routes suitable for different touring cycling preferences.

In the interior of Thassos you will come across several mountain villages. Perhaps the most interesting and certainly the oldest of them is Kastro, which you will find above the resort of Limenaria (about 12 kilometers of driving on a wide and decent asphalt road). The village lies at an altitude of almost 500 meters above sea level. The village is almost completely deserted - only two families currently live here. One of them runs a tavern, so you can also get some refreshments here.

The old settlement stands in the mountains in the very center of the island of Thassos, at a height of about 600m above sea level, a dirt road leads to it from Limenaria, via Kalivia. The village has a small square with a huge oak tree, in its shadow stands a cafe. There is also a church here, stone houses are scattered between the old walls from 1403. The castle was inhabited until the end of the 19th century, then the gradual eviction of the inhabitants began. Today, only a few residents live here, they mostly return to Limenaria for the winter, after the herding season. The white church of the cemetery stands on the edge of the village, and it is also surrounded by medieval walls with a chapel. Nearby is the "kinsterna" - a castle reservoir with water.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es in the park?

The park offers diverse terrain for touring cyclists. You'll find routes through extensive wetlands, along a 100 km coastline, and into the mountainous Rhodope region. This includes flat, paved surfaces around areas like the Nestos Delta and Lake Vistonida, as well as routes with significant elevation gain in more inland, hilly areas.

What natural landmarks or attractions can I see while cycling in East Macedonia-Thrace National Park?

The park is rich in natural beauty and landmarks. You can cycle past the significant wetlands of the Lake Vistonida and the Nestos Delta, known for their diverse birdlife. Other notable sights include the Porto Lagos Harbor and the historic Iasmos Bridge over the Kompsatos River. The Aesthetic Forest of the Straits of Nestos also offers unique flora and fauna.

What is the best time of year for touring cycling in East Macedonia-Thrace National Park?

The spring and autumn months are generally ideal for touring cycling in East Macedonia-Thrace National Park. During these seasons, the weather is typically milder, and the natural landscapes are at their most vibrant, making for a more comfortable and enjoyable experience. Summers can be hot, especially in the open wetland areas.
